Three men charged with arson for setting fire to Jewish community ambulances in London, labeled an antisemitic attack.

Three men charged following the attack appeared at court this morning, and have since been remanded in custody.

Hamza Iqbal, 20, and Rehan Khan, 19, both British nationals from Leyton, and a 17-year-old boy, a dual British and Pakistani national from Walthamstow have been remanded in custody
